Versatile Video Coding

Versatile Video Coding (VVC), también conocido como H.266,[1]ISO/IEC 23090-3,[2]​ y MPEG-I Part 3, es un estándar de compresión de vídeo finalizado el 6 de julio de 2020, por el Joint Video Experts Team (JVET),[3]​ un equipo de expertos en video formado por miembros de los grupos VCEG y MPEG. Es el sucesor de High Efficiency Video Coding (HEVC, también conocido como ITU-T H.265 y MPEG-H Parte 2). Se desarrolló con dos objetivos principales: mejorar el rendimiento de la compresión y admitir una gama muy amplia de aplicaciones.[4][5][6]

Versatile Video Coding
Nombre completo Versatile Video Coding (VVC / H.266 / MPEG-I Part 3)
Tipo de estándar recomendación ITU-T
Estado En vigor
Fundación 2017
Primera publicación 2020
Última versión 29 de abril de 2022 (Segunda edición)
Organización ITU-T, ISO, IEC
Autores VCEG y MPEG
Estándares base H.261, H.262, H.263, H.264, H.265, MPEG-1
Dominio Compresión de video
Licencia RAND
Sitio web www.itu.int/rec/T-REC-H.266

Concepto

editar

En octubre de 2015, los grupos MPEG y VCEG formaron el Joint Video Exploration Team (JVET) para evaluar las tecnologías de compresión disponibles y estudiar los requisitos de un estándar de compresión de vídeo de próxima generación. El nuevo estándar tiene alrededor de un 50% más de tasa de compresión para la misma calidad perceptual, con soporte para compresión sin pérdida y subjetivamente sin pérdida. Admite resoluciones desde muy baja resolución hasta 4K y 16K, así como vídeos de 360°. VVC admite YCbCr 4:4:4, 4:2:2 y 4:2:0 con 8-10 bits por componente, gama amplia de colores BT.2100 y alto rango dinámico (HDR) de más de 16 stops (con picos de brillo de 1000, 4000 y 10000 nits), canales auxiliares (para profundidad, transparencia, etc.), frecuencias de cuadro variables y fraccionarias de 0 a 120 Hz y superiores, codificación de vídeo escalable para diferencias temporales (frecuencia de cuadro), espaciales (resolución), SNR, de gama de colores y de rango dinámico, codificación estéreo/multivista, formatos panorámicos y codificación de imágenes fijas. Los trabajos sobre el soporte de alta profundidad de bits (de 12 a 16 bits por componente) comenzaron en octubre de 2020[7]​ y se incluyeron en la segunda edición publicada en 2022. Se espera una complejidad de codificación varias veces (hasta diez veces) superior a la de HEVC, dependiendo de la calidad del algoritmo de codificación (que queda fuera del ámbito de la norma). La complejidad de descodificación es aproximadamente el doble que la de HEVC.

El desarrollo de VVC se ha realizado utilizando el VVC Test Model (VTM), un software de referencia que se inició con un conjunto mínimo de herramientas de codificación. Se han añadido más herramientas de codificación después de haber sido probadas en Experimentos Básicos (Core Experiments, CE). Su predecesor fue el Joint Exploration Model (JEM), un software experimental basado en el software de referencia utilizado para HEVC.

Historia

editar

JVET publicó una convocatoria de propuestas final en octubre de 2017, y el proceso de estandarización comenzó oficialmente en abril de 2018, cuando se elaboró el primer borrador del estándar.[8][9]

En la International Broadcasting Convention (IBC) 2018, se demostró una implementación preliminar basada en VVC que, según se dijo, comprimía vídeo un 40 % más eficientemente que HEVC.[10]

El contenido final del estándar se aprobó el 6 de julio de 2020.[11][12][13]

Calendario

editar
  • Octubre de 2017: Convocatoria de propuestas
  • Abril de 2018: Evaluación de las propuestas recibidas y primer borrador de la norma[14]
  • Julio de 2019: Votación del borrador del comité
  • Octubre de 2019: Votación del borrador de la norma internacional
  • 6 de julio de 2020: Finalización de la norma definitiva

Licencias

editar

Para reducir el riesgo de problemas observados al conceder licencias a las implementaciones de HEVC, para VVC se fundó un nuevo grupo llamado Media Coding Industry Forum (MC-IF).[15][16]​ Sin embargo, el MC-IF no tenía ningún poder sobre el proceso de estandarización, que se basaba en los méritos técnicos determinados por las decisiones consensuadas del JVET.[17]

En un principio, cuatro empresas competían por ser las administradores del consorcio de patentes del VVC, en una situación similar a la de los anteriores códecs AVC[18]​ y HEVC[19]​. Más tarde se informaron las dos empresas ganadoras: Access Advance y MPEG LA.[20]

Access Advance ya ha publicado el importe de la licencia.[21]

Adopción

editar

Software

editar
  • Fraunhofer Versatile Video Encoder (VVenC)[23]​ & Decoder (VVdeC).[24]​ Escrito en C++ . 70x más rápido que software de referencia.[25]
    Decodificador Version 1.0.0 en III2021,[26]​ Codificador Version 1.0.0 en V2021 .[27]
  • Real Time 8K VVC Decoder - Sharp Corporation. Decodificador en Tiempo real.[28]
  • GPAC maneja VVC desde la versión 1.1,[29]​ actualmente disponible como versión para desarrolladores[30]​ (a septiembre de 2021)
  • La empresa MultiCoreware está desarrollando un codificador VVC de código abierto con x266.[31][32]
  • Tencent Media Lab está desarrollando un decodificador (comercial) en Tiempo real H.266.[33]
  • El analizador de video (comercial) de Elecard es compatible con VVC.[34]
  • Spin Digital ofrece un decodificador y reproductor VVC en Tiempo real.[35]
  • El IETR francés desarrolla un decodificador en Tiempo real OpenVVC [36]​ y una versión especial de FFmpeg[37]​ que se utilizó para la prueba[38]​ de transmisión ATEME junto con el reproductor multimedia VideoLAN.[39]

Hardware

editar
  • Con el AL-D320, Allegro DVT proporciona un IP-Core con funcionalidad de decodificador VVC para integración en hardware, así como decodificación de AV1, VP9, H.265/HEVC y compatible con H.264/AVC.[40][41]
  • La empresa MediaTek ha diseñado y fabricado chip Pentonic 2000 - un Decodificador 8K con H266 para TV 8K.[42]

Servicios

editar

Radiodifusión

editar

El Foro SBTVD de Brasil seleccionó a VVC para la próxima TV 3.0 de Brasil El Foro SBTVD de Brasil adoptará el códec MPEG-I VVC en su próximo sistema de transmisión de televisión, TV 3.0, cuyo lanzamiento se espera para 2024. Se usará junto con Mpeg-5 LC EVC como un codificador de capa base de video para la entrega de broadcast y broadband.[47]

Véase también

editar

Referencias

editar
  1. «H.266: Versatile video coding». www.itu.int. Archivado desde el original el 21 de junio de 2021. Consultado el 21 de junio de 2021. 
  2. «Information technology — Coded representation of immersive media — Part 3: Versatile video coding» (en inglés). International Organization for Standardization. Consultado el 16 de febrero de 2021. 
  3. «JVET - Joint Video Experts Team». www.itu.int. Consultado el 21 de enero de 2019. 
  4. Bross, Benjamin; Chen, Jianle; Ohm, Jens-Rainer; Sullivan, Gary J.; Wang, Ye-Kui (September 2021). «Developments in International Video Coding Standardization After AVC, With an Overview of Versatile Video Coding (VVC)». Proceedings of the IEEE 109 (9): 1463-1493. S2CID 234183758. doi:10.1109/JPROC.2020.3043399. 
  5. Bross, Benjamin; Wang, Ye-Kui; Ye, Yan; Liu, Shan; Sullivan, Gary J.; Ohm, Jens-Rainer (October 2021). «Overview of the Versatile Video Coding (VVC) Standard and its Applications». IEEE Trans. Circuits & Systs. For Video Technol. 31 (10): 3736-3764. S2CID 238243504. doi:10.1109/TCSVT.2021.3101953. 
  6. Boyce, Jill M.; Chen, Jianle; Liu, Shan; Ohm, Jens-Rainer; Sullivan, Gary J.; Wiegand, Thomas; Ye, Yan; Zhu, Wenwu (October 2021). «Guest Editorial Introduction to the Special Section on the VVC Standard». IEEE Trans. Circuits & Systs. For Video Technol. 31 (10): 3731-3735. S2CID 238425004. doi:10.1109/TCSVT.2021.3111712. 
  7. T. Ikai; T. Zhou; T. Hashimoto. «AHG12: VVC coding tool evaluation for high bit-depth coding». JVET document management system. 
  8. «N17195, Joint Call for Proposals on Video Compression with Capability beyond HEVC». mpeg.chiariglione.org. Consultado el 21 de enero de 2019. 
  9. «N17669, Working Draft 1 of Versatile Video Coding». mpeg.chiariglione.org. Consultado el 18 de agosto de 2019. 
  10. «Fraunhofer Institut zeigt 50% besseren HEVC Nachfolger VVC auf der // IBC 2018». slashCAM (en alemán). Consultado el 21 de enero de 2019. 
  11. «Fraunhofer Heinrich Hertz Institute HHI». newsletter.fraunhofer.de. Consultado el 8 de julio de 2020. 
  12. «Versatile Video Coding | MPEG». mpeg.chiariglione.org. Consultado el 21 de enero de 2019. 
  13. ITU (27 de abril de 2018). «Beyond HEVC: Versatile Video Coding project starts strongly in Joint Video Experts Team». ITU News (en inglés). Archivado desde el original el 21 de junio de 2021. Consultado el 21 de junio de 2021. 
  14. «JVET-J1001: Versatile Video Coding (Draft 1)». April 2018. 
  15. Ozer, Jan (13 de enero de 2019). «A Video Codec Licensing Update». Streaming Media. Consultado el 21 de enero de 2019. 
  16. «MC-IF». mc-if (en inglés). Consultado el 21 de enero de 2019. 
  17. Feldman, Christian (7 de mayo de 2019). «Video Engineering Summit East 2019 – AV1/VVC Update». New York. Archivado desde el original el 20 de junio de 2019. Consultado el 20 de junio de 2019. «No change to the standardization has been done, so it could theoretically happen that the same thing with HEVC happens again. No measures have been done to prevent that, unfortunately. Also, JVET is not directly responsible; they are just a technical committee. (…) There is the Media Coding Industry Forum (…), but they don't have any real power.» 
  18. Siglin, Timothy (12 de febrero de 2009). «The H.264 Licensing Labyrinth». Streaming Media (en inglés estadounidense). Consultado el 8 de julio de 2020. 
  19. Ozer, Jan (17 de enero de 2020). «Balance of Power Shifts Among HEVC Patent Pools». Streaming Media (en inglés estadounidense). Consultado el 8 de julio de 2020. 
  20. Ozer, Jan (28 de enero de 2021). «VVC Patent Pools: And Then There Were Two». Streaming Media (en inglés). Consultado el 23 de febrero de 2021. 
  21. Eltzroth, Carter; Cary, Judson (2021). «Fostering of Patent Pools Covering Cable Technology: Lessons from VVC Pool Fostering». SSRN Electronic Journal. ISSN 1556-5068. S2CID 243836590. doi:10.2139/ssrn.3949545. 
  22. «Projects · jvet / VVCSoftware_VTM» (en inglés). Consultado el 18 de octubre de 2020. 
  23. «fraunhoferhhi/vvenc». Fraunhofer HHI. 14 de octubre de 2020. Consultado el 18 de octubre de 2020. 
  24. «fraunhoferhhi/vvdec». Fraunhofer HHI. 19 de octubre de 2020. Consultado el 19 de octubre de 2020. 
  25. «What‘s new with Versatile Video Coding – Video Compression with Optimized Implementations - YouTube». Consultado el 23 de diciembre de 2020. 
  26. «Release vvdec-1.0.0 · fraunhoferhhi/vvdec» (en inglés). Consultado el 13 de marzo de 2021. 
  27. «Release vvenc-1.0.0 · fraunhoferhhi/vvenc» (en inglés). Consultado el 25 de mayo de 2021. 
  28. SHARP CORPORATION. «Sharp Develops 8K Real-time VVC Decoder, a World First» (en inglés). Consultado el 13 de marzo de 2021. 
  29. «gpac/Changelog at master · gpac/gpac» (en inglés). Consultado el 9 de septiembre de 2021. 
  30. «GPAC Nightly Builds | GPAC» (en inglés estadounidense). Consultado el 9 de septiembre de 2021. 
  31. «x266 - Un código fuente abierto de última generación para codificación VVC de MulticoreWare Inc | Noticias» (en inglés estadounidense). Consultado el 23 de agosto de 2021. 
  32. «x266™ - VVC codificador | x266™ Codificador | Códec HEVC | MulticoreWare» (en inglés estadounidense). Consultado el 23 de agosto de 2021. 
  33. Tencent (22 de junio de 2021). «Decodificador H.266 / VVC en tiempo real de alto rendimiento ahora disponible en Tencent Media Lab» (en inglés). Tencent. Archivado desde el original el 22 de junio de 2021. Consultado el 22 de junio de 2021. 
  34. «Elecard Video Analyzers Ahora es compatible con VVC | Elecard: Video Compression Guru». Consultado el 29 de junio de 2021. 
  35. «Spin Digital - 8K VVC Media Player (Spin Player VVC)». Spin Digital (en inglés estadounidense). Consultado el 20 de agosto de 2021. 
  36. IETR. «OpenVVC French VVC Decoder» (en inglés). Consultado el 30 de septiembre de 2021. 
  37. IETR. «Modified FFmpeg for VVC» (en inglés). Consultado el 30 de septiembre de 2021. 
  38. «ATEME Joins Forces with SES to Trial First-Ever Live Over-The-Air UHD Broadcast Using VVC – ATEME» (en inglés británico). Consultado el 14 de julio de 2020. 
  39. ouest-valorisation.fr. «DÉCODEUR VIDÉO VVC TEMPS RÉEL» (en francés). Consultado el 30 de septiembre de 2021. 
  40. «Decodificador de IP AV1 8K Multiformatos de video IP AV1 422 Escalable». Allegro DVT - Experiencia líder en compresión de video (en inglés estadounidense). Consultado el 2 de julio de 2021. 
  41. «Primer núcleo IP del decodificador de video VVC / H.266 de hardware» (en inglés). 1 de julio de 2021. Consultado el 2 de julio de 2021. 
  42. Inc, MediaTek. «MediaTek Announces New Pentonic Smart TV Family with New Pentonic 2000 for Flagship 8K 120Hz TVs». www.prnewswire.com (en inglés). Consultado el 20 de noviembre de 2021. 
  43. «MX Player cuts down video streaming data consumption by half; upgrades its video encoding and compression technology to H.266». businessinsider.in (en inglés). Consultado el 17 de junio de 2021. 
  44. «How the H.266 video standard will help stream content way faster(Coming to a screen in your home soon)». The Next Web (en inglés). Consultado el 7 de septiembre de 2021. 
  45. «Novyy kodek H.266 uprostit striming "tyazhelogo" video». Smotrim (en ruso). Consultado el 7 de septiembre de 2021. 
  46. birdie. «HEVC successor: Versatile Video Coding». Doom9 Forum (en inglés). Consultado el 7 de septiembre de 2021. 
  47. «Brazilian SBTVD Forum selecciona V-Nova LCEVC para la próxima TV 3.0 de Brasil». digitalmediaworld.tv (en inglés). Consultado el 13 de enero de 2022. 

Enlaces externos

editar
  NODES
admin 1
INTERN 5
Project 2